How bacterial cells are made competent to take up DNA?

Answer

Bacterial cell is made competent so that it can take up DNA. Taking up DNA is not easy as it is hydrophilic molecule and cannot pass through cell membrane. Bacterial cell can be made competent by treating it with a specific concentration of a divalent cation such as calcium as it increases the efficiency with which DNA can enter the bacteria through it the pores of cell wall.
